Kerry Young joined Congressional Quarterly in 2007 as co-editor of Budget Tracker, an electronic newsletter and Web site on the budget and appropriations. She produces a daily newsletter when Congress is in session, reporting on how laws get passed to allow the federal government to spend money. She also keeps track of efforts to reduce waste in government and control deficit spending and the debt. She’s a veteran of Bloomberg News, where from 1995 to 2006 she covered energy and health, including the FDA and Medicare. Kerry worked for several small newspapers in New Jersey at the start of her career in the early 1990s, and considers those years some of her most enjoyable as a journalist.
